WebMay 31, 2024 · By Cary Hardy May 31, 2024. Gold is primarily found as the pure, native metal. Sylvanite and calaverite are gold-bearing minerals. Gold is usually found embedded in quartz veins, or placer stream gravel. It is mined in South Africa, the USA (Nevada, Alaska), Russia, Australia and Canada. WebApr 24, 2024 · Quartz. •••. Gold is most often found in quartz rock. When quartz is found in gold bearings areas, it is possible that gold will be found as well.
